With the uproar by Congress members showing no signs of abating, the Rajya Sabha has been adjourned for the day. Opposition leaders protested the rejection of their notice in the upper house demanding an explanation and apology from Prime Minister Narendra Modi over his “conspiracy with Pakistan” remark involving his predecessor Manmohan Singh.

Describing the comment “unfortunate”, Congress leaders told reporters outside the House it was “disappointing” that Rajya Sabha chairman M Venkaiah Naidu did not allow a discussion on the notice.

Winter Session of Parliament, which began Friday, is likely to witness discussions on 25 pending and 14 new Bills that will be tabled by the government. These include significant legislation on instant triple talaq, GST, and the Insolvency Bill. At the customary all-party meeting a day earlier, Prime Minister Narendra Modi sought cooperation from Opposition members for a constructive session. He also put forward his suggestion for simultaneous Lok Sabha and Assembly elections in order to maximise governance. The Winter Session, which generally begins in the third week of November, was delayed this year due to Gujarat and Himachal Assembly elections.

10.15 am: For the first time since 2007, Parliament was not in session on December 13, the date when it was attacked and 14 people, mostly from the security forces, were killed. On the day, the remembrance ceremony usually happens with a lot of ardour.

9.30 am: Congress leaders are expected to protest PM Narendra Modi’s remarks on former prime minister Manmohan Singh. During the campaign for Gujarat elections, Modi had alleged that Singh and other Congress leaders collaborated with Pakistan to influence the Gujarat polls. Congress’s deputy leader in Rajya Sabha Anand Sharma said, “Either the government prove the claim or the PM apologise. Nothing short of an apology will satisfy us.”
